Driveway Pavers Replacement in Davis County, UT

Driveway pavers replacement services involve removing and replacing existing driveway surfaces with new paving materials to improve appearance, functionality, and durability. This service covers a variety of projects, including replacing cracked or worn-out pavers, upgrading to more durable materials, or redesigning the driveway layout for better curb appeal. Homeowners typically seek this service when their current driveway shows signs of damage, uneven surfaces, or when planning a complete overhaul to enhance the overall look of their property.

Before requesting driveway pavers replacement, property owners should consider the condition of their existing driveway, the types of materials they prefer, and any structural issues that may need addressing beforehand. It’s also helpful to understand the different paving options available, such as concrete, brick, or stone, and how each can complement the style of the home. Clarifying project scope, budget, and desired timeline can ensure the replacement process aligns with property owners’ expectations.

Driveway Pavers Replacement Questions

What are common reasons to replace a driveway paver? Signs include extensive cracking, uneven surfaces, or significant damage that affects safety and appearance.

What types of driveway paver materials are available? Options typically include concrete, brick, and natural stone, each offering different styles and durability.

How can I tell if my driveway needs replacement? Visible damage such as large cracks, sinking, or loose pavers indicate it may be time for a replacement.

What should property owners consider before replacing driveway pavers? Factors include the existing foundation, drainage, and the desired style or material for the new surface.
